Default Nock point issue

I use a tied on nock point with braided serving material, lots of knots then superglued to itself.

Have shot like this for a few months without issue.

Today I was shooting really low, discovered my nock point had slipped up a good 3/8".

Corrected it, then tied off above it with dental floss. However I'm now nervous as $*%@ knowing with my luck Murphy is usually right around the corner.

I have contemplated gluing it to the serving, but I use a B-50 string that may still stretch, and am not convinced that if it does stretch when I twist it back up the nock point will be in the same spot. Will it?

What do you use for a nock point? Any slipping problems?
